1905 1ed Tokio by Manchuria Seaman Tokyo Japan Hiroshima Nagasaki IllustratedLouis Seaman was an American military surgeon serving in Manchuria during the Russo-Japanese War who wrote of his experience in the book 'From Tokio through Manchuria with the Japanese.' Seaman included information on military medicine, hospital conditions, treatment of prisoners, Hiroshima, Nagasaki, Naval Battles, Russian soldiers and submarine mines, China, Manchurian bandits, and much more!
This 1905 first edition includes the author's inscription along with 43 illustrations throughout with a decorative red cloth binding.

Flat with plastic against dirtExcellent early map of the region. Kansas counties cover only the eastern third of the state. Nebraska counties cover less than half the state. Colorado has only approximately 15 counties. The gold regions near Denver are shown, as are a number of Indian tribes, early towns, forts, etc. Dakota includes all of Wyoming.The map shows early proposed railroads, forts, Indian tribes, rivers, mountains, etc. The plains region is still very much in transition, with the results of several major explorations commenced immediately after the civil war are not yet in evidence.
Also shows portions of New Mexico, Texas and Indian Territory.

Good run of six monthly issues of this influential magazine, Third Series, Volume I, January to June 1823, bound in one volume. A fascinating view of the taste of London high society in the year 1823.Complete with 29 handcoloured engravings of fashion, landscapes, architecture and furniture, 6 engravings of needlework patterns, one engraved fold-out music score of a German waltz by Beethoven, and one engraved plate of a military trophy.Each issue typically with two handcoloured architecture plates, two handcoloured London fashion plates, one handcoloured interior plate (furniture, curtains, etc.) and one needlework pattern.The fashion plates unsigned but attributed to the Arbiter Elegantiarum (Thomas Uwins). The fashions include bonnets and hats, casual morning and promenade dresses as well as elegant evening wear and ball gowns, a few by Miss Pierpoint of 9 Henrietta Street, Covent Garden, the others by anonymous designers. 1690 Lucian Samosata Philosophers for Sale Greek Satire Mythology Philosophy A rare, late 17th-century edition of the works of Lucian of Samosata, a 2nd-century Greek satirist. Lucian wrote a variety of works including comedies, dialogues, essays, and commentaries. He discusses mythological figures such as Hercules, Achilles, Zeus, Timon of Athens, Hermes, and others. One of his lesser known (but no less important) works was 'Philosophers for Sale'. This work is a satirical comedy where Lucian mocks philosophers by creating a scene where they are for sale at a market.
This 1690 edition was published and edited by Laurent Bordelon in Paris.

1899 Famous Violinists Classical VIOLIN MUSIC Paganini Mozart Handel Haydn BachHenry Lahee was a 19th-century music historian and writer known for his references on and biographical sketches of famous musicians. One of his best works was his 'Famous Violinists of Today and Yesterday' – a treatise recounting the music, lives, and careers of famous violinists.
In this work, Lahee covers numerous violinists but none more important than Niccolo Paganini. Even today, Paganini is considered to be one of, if not the most important violinists ever to play. His virtuosity, incredible composition, and concert performances placed him at the top of the musical world in the 19th-century.
Other notable composers and musicians featured in this work include Antonio Vivaldi, Arcangelo Corelli, J.S. Bach, Handel, Mozart, and Haydn.
